Spirit 1.8 has a directive called limit_d which allowed to set the value range. Is there an equivalent for this in Spirit 2.x?
There is not anything like this, but you can achieve the same with a semantic action:
limit_d(min, max)[uint_p]
is equivalent to (when using qi::uint_, qi::_pass, and qi::_1):
uint_[_pass = (min <= _1 && _1 <= max)]
